Abstract

Critical thinking ability is one of the essential skills that need to be developed in physics learning in the 21st century. However, students' critical thinking ability has not yet developed optimally, so a learning model that can actively involve students in problem solving is needed. One alternative that can be applied is the STEM–PjBL learning model. This study aims to analyze the effect of the STEM–PjBL learning model on students' critical thinking ability on temperature and heat material. The study used a quantitative approach with a quasi-experimental method and a nonequivalent control group design. The research sample consisted of 42 students of grade XI MA Tohir Yasin who were selected using a purposive sampling technique. Data were collected using a valid and reliable essay test, then analyzed using descriptive statistics and the Mann–Whitney U test. The results showed that the average posttest score of the experimental class (79.77) was higher than that of the control class (68.75), with a significance value of 0.005 (p < 0.05). Thus, the application of the STEM–PjBL learning model has a significant effect on students' critical thinking skills on temperature and heat material and can be an alternative physics learning method to develop critical thinking skills.

Abstract

This community service program aimed to optimize the utilization of gadung tubers (Dioscorea hispida) as a botanical pesticide through a participatory community empowerment approach in Pandan Wangi Village, East Lombok Regency. The program involved three farmer groups and was implemented through demonstration, discussion, and hands-on practice. Program evaluation was conducted through participatory observation, discussions, documentation, and question-and-answer sessions, while the collected data were analyzed descriptively using a qualitative approach. The results showed that the participants understood the process of preparing and applying the botanical pesticide, as demonstrated by their ability to explain the preparation procedures, the functions of each material, and the application techniques during the evaluation sessions. Participants also showed positive responses toward the utilization of local resources as an environmentally friendly alternative for pest management and actively participated throughout the program. In addition, the program successfully produced a botanical pesticide derived from gadung tubers as one of its outputs. These findings indicate that optimizing local resources through a participatory approach effectively improves community knowledge and practical skills while fostering greater awareness of utilizing local potential to support environmentally friendly and sustainable agriculture
